Margins: For Purchases and Balance Transfers, 9.74%, 14.74% or 19.74%will be added to the Index; for Cash Advances, 19.99% will be added to the Index.

Index: The APRs that apply to your Account are subject to change each Billing Cycle with changes to the Index. The Index is

the Prime Rate (U.S.) as published in the Money Rates section of The Wall Street Journal. As of 03/01/2015, the Prime Rate was 3.25%.

How the Variable APRs on your Account are Determined: The APRs on your Account will be determined each billing cycle

by adding a margin to the Index. Please see your Personal Credit Card Agreement for more information.

Balance Transfers: You may be able to transfer balances from eligible credit card accounts to your TD Bank Credit Card

Account. Balance Transfers are subject to a fee based on the amount of the transfer with a minimum fee as indicated

in the Fees Table and are subject to your available credit limit. The minimum Balance Transfer amount is $250 (plus the

applicable Balance Transfer transaction fee for the Account).

We may limit the number and types of credit card accounts from which we will allow Balance Transfers, and the times, manner, and circumstances in which Balance Transfers may be requested. Balance Transfers may not be payable to yourself or made payable to cash. Balance Transfers may be used to pay off other creditors, but cannot be used to pay off accounts owned by TD Bank or to any bank now or previously affiliated with TD Bank.

Should your balance transfer request be approved, the Balance Transfer transaction fee will be reflected on your first monthly billing statement following the transfer. The amount of the Balance Transfer transaction fee will be added to your

minimum monthly payment amount. Each month you must pay at least the full amount of your minimum monthly payment

which will include any Balance Transfer transaction fee(s) by the payment due date specified on that statement.

It may take 2 to 4 weeks to process a Balance Transfer request after your account is opened. You must continue paying each of your creditors until the requested Balance Transfer appears on your monthly billing statement sent to you by your creditor as a credit. Your other credit card account(s) will not be closed even if you transfer your entire balance(s). If you want to close an account, please contact your other creditors directly.

Transfers requested with Convenience Checks are processed as Cash Advances, not as Balance Transfers. If you

have a dispute with a creditor and pay that creditor with a Balance Transfer or Convenience Check, you may lose certain dispute rights with that creditor.

Cash Advances: Cash Advances obtained from a financial institution, an automated teller machine, or any other party that

agrees to honor the credit card for Cash Advance purposes, and all Convenience Checks (including Convenience Checks used to transfer balances) posted to your account are considered Cash Advances. Cash Advances are subject to a transaction fee (see Fee Table above) and the Cash Advance transaction fee charge will appear on your first monthly billing statement following the Cash Advance, and that applicable Cash Advance transaction fee amount will be added to your minimum payment amount which will be due on the payment due date specified on that statement.

Foreign Transaction Fees: TD Bank will impose a 3% foreign transaction fee on the converted U.S. Dollar amount of the

transaction and any transaction made outside the U.S. Account transactions (including Purchases and Cash Advances) made in a foreign currency will be converted to U.S. Dollars by or on behalf of Visa U.S.A. Inc. (or any of its affiliates) using its currency conversion procedures and charges then in effect, as of the date on which the transaction is first posted to the VISA system

.

Foreign Transactions are subject to a transaction fee (see Fee Table above) and the Foreign Transaction Fee charge will appear on your first monthly billing statement following the foreign transaction, and that applicable Foreign Transaction fee amount will be added to your minimum payment amount which will be due on the payment due date specified on that statement.

How to Avoid Paying Interest on Purchases: We charge interest on Balance Transfers and Cash Advances beginning on

the transaction date (see your account disclosure for the applicable APR, including any promotional rates). We charge interest on purchases beginning on the transactions date unless you pay your entire balance, which includes all Purchases, Cash Advances and Balance Transfers by the payment due date each and every month. Please see your Personal Credit Card Agreement for more details.

IMPORTANT INFORMATION ABOUT THE TD EASY REWARDS PROGRAM How do I earn Easy Rewards under the TD Easy Rewards Visa Program?

You will earn one (1) Easy Rewards Point for each one dollar ($1.00) of all Net Purchases made using the Credit Card. Easy Rewards Points are earned on retail purchases made with the TD Easy Rewards Visa Credit Card ("Credit Card"), less credits, returns, and adjustments ("Net Purchases"). Balance Transfers, Cash Advances, purchases made by or for a business or for a business purpose, purchases of travelers checks, money orders, lottery tickets, gambling chips, wire transfers, foreign currency, purchases or reloading of prepaid cards, or purchases of any other cash equivalents, fees, interest charges, and unauthorized/fraudulent transactions do not earn Easy Rewards Points.

What event can cause the Easy Rewards Bonus Period to end early?

Missing two consecutive minimum monthly payments causes early termination of the Easy Rewards Bonus Period. Upon expiration or termination of the Easy Rewards Bonus Period, you will earn one (1) Easy Rewards Point on all Net Purchases charged to the Credit Card Account.

When do Easy Rewards Points post to my Account?

Easy Rewards Points are posted to your Account each billing cycle based on Net Purchases that post to your Account within that billing cycle. Any returned items will be deducted from the Points earned.

How can I redeem my Easy Rewards Points?

Easy Rewards Points may be redeemed upon request of the primary account holder at specified levels for a variety of merchandise, cash back, gift cards, and travel rewards found at tdbank.com/rewards. Specific merchandise, gift cards, and travel rewards are subject to availability, and include only those participating partners found at tdbank.com/rewards. In order to redeem your Points for cash back, Points earned must correspond to a minimum of 2,500 Points which equals a minimum of a $25 cash value. For details on how to redeem Points for cash back visit tdbank.com/rewards or call the Rewards Center at 1-877-745-5040.

Do Easy Rewards Points expire?

For as long as the Account remains open and in good standing, Easy Rewards Points will not expire, except for Easy Rewards Bonus Points, and there is no restriction to the number of Points that may be earned annually. Your Points will be forfeited if your Account is closed for any reason, whether by you or by us. See below for additional restrictions.

Are there any restrictions on redemption of Easy Rewards Points?

Your Account must be open and in good standing in order to redeem Easy Rewards Points. If your Account is closed for any reason, by you or by TD Bank, your participation in Easy Rewards will be terminated and the total balance of any unredeemed/accumulated Points will be forfeited. You will also forfeit any unredeemed/accumulated Points if you cancel your Easy Rewards participation or if Easy Rewards is terminated. We may, at our sole discretion, cancel, modify, restrict, or terminate Easy Rewards or any aspects or features of Easy Rewards at any time without prior notice. All interpretations of Easy Rewards terms and conditions shall be at our sole discretion. In the event of any fraudulent, abusive, or gaming activity related to Easy Rewards, as determined by us in our discretion, we reserve the right to make adjustments to your Easy Rewards Point accruals,and/or to cancel your participation in Easy Rewards, and/or close your Account at any time. Easy Rewards Points have no cash value except when redeemed in connection with the TD Easy Rewards Program, and may not be used in place of payment of any portion of a required Minimum Monthly Payment or any other required payment on a credit card or other account owed to TD Bank. Easy Rewards Points may not be transferred or assigned.
